Itinerary
- Guest Pickup
Begin your adventure with a pickup at the Downtown Anchorage Visitors Center. - Turnagain Arm Scenic Drive
Enjoy a stunning drive along Turnagain Arm, a route famous for its mountain views and opportunities to spot wildlife like moose, bald eagles, and possibly beluga whales in the waters of Cook Inlet. - Alaska Wildlife Conservation Center
Visit the AWCC, a 200-acre sanctuary for rescued and orphaned wildlife. Witness bears, moose, bison, and musk oxen in a safe environment while learning about Alaska’s conservation efforts. - Alyeska Resort & Tram Ride
Travel to Alyeska Resort in Girdwood, arriving around noon. From there, enjoy a scenic tram ride ascending 2,300 feet above sea level for spectacular views of the surrounding glaciers and mountains. - Book Your Girdwood Express
Remember to book your Girdwood Express return tickets online in advance, as seats are limited. - Return to Anchorage
After your tram experience, return to Anchorage, relaxing on the drive back to your original pickup location.
